Output 62f1e5b19a03984b8c5b1ebbfa644057853bcb08c88db06d4f009b47590534c5:1

value
31582561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ae917f65e9c30aeb1a7b4a3f3af4c2d300799ae OP_EQUAL
address
3MeWTzPU3Kj5NB6NnkFevKi7To8KVk4FPm
transaction
62f1e5b19a03984b8c5b1ebbfa644057853bcb08c88db06d4f009b47590534c5
confirmations
295476
spent
true